What it is

Microneedling for hair is a scalp treatment that uses fine needles to create controlled micro-channels in the scalp, stimulating the follicles and helping drive serums into the follicles to support hair growth and density.

Microneedling for hair uses advanced micro-needle technology to stimulate hair follicle regeneration and improve overall hair density. The fine needles create controlled micro-channels in the scalp, triggering the body's natural healing response, supporting collagen production, increasing blood circulation and helping to revitalise dormant follicles.

Those same micro-channels also allow targeted serums to reach the follicles more directly, which is why microneedling is often combined with nourishing scalp serums, mesotherapy or hair injectables as part of a wider hair-restoration plan. The approach is matched to your scalp and goals rather than applied to a fixed formula.

Who it’s not for

A few situations mean it’s better to wait, or to choose a different treatment:

  • An active scalp infection, inflammation or broken skin in the treatment area
  • Pregnancy or breastfeeding
  • A bleeding disorder or use of anticoagulant (blood-thinning) medication
  • Certain scalp conditions, such as active psoriasis or eczema on the scalp

This isn’t exhaustive, and none of it rules you out on its own — your clinician confirms suitability at consultation.

Physician note

On Microneedling for Hair

Microneedling rarely does its best work alone. I treat it as a delivery step as much as a stimulating one — the micro-channels let a well-chosen serum reach the follicle, so I usually plan it as a short course alongside the right topical or injectable support. Before any of that, I want to understand why the hair is thinning; pattern and cause shape the plan far more than the device does, and they tell us how realistic a result to expect.

Questions

01Is microneedling for hair safe?
Yes. It is minimally invasive and performed by trained clinicians following strict hygiene protocols under DHA-licensed medical supervision. Your clinician confirms suitability and reviews any scalp conditions or medications first.
02When will I see results?
Visible improvements often appear within weeks, with progressive enhancement over a course of treatments. Hair growth is gradual by nature, so results build session by session rather than appearing overnight.
03How many sessions will I need?
Typically a course of sessions spaced over several weeks is recommended for the best result, with the exact cadence personalised to your scalp and goals at consultation.
04Is there downtime after treatment?
Downtime is minimal and most people resume normal activities straight after. Temporary mild redness or sensitivity in the treated area can occur but usually settles quickly. Your clinician gives you full aftercare guidance.
05Is it combined with other hair treatments?
Often, yes. The micro-channels created in the scalp help targeted serums reach the follicles, so microneedling is commonly paired with nourishing serums, mesotherapy or hair injectables as part of a wider hair-restoration plan. Your clinician advises whether a combined approach suits you.
